Defect description

Navistar, Inc. (Navistar) is recalling certain 2019 International LT heavy diesel trucks equipped with feature codes 29WAY, 504312, and 504455. The lightweight brake drums with slack adjusters may drag against the brakes causing the drums to overheat which can result in the brake drum cracking, separating from the vehicle or the brakes becoming inoperative.

Safety risk

If the brake drum separates or if the brakes become inoperative, it can increase the risk of a crash.

Manufacturer remedy

Navistar has notified owners, and dealers will replace the brake drums and slack adjusters and replace the brake linings, free of charge. The recall began on May 23, 2018. Owners may contact Navistar customer service at 1-800-448-7825. Navistar's number for this recall is 18507.
